文摘Protein kinases play an important role in every aspect of cellular life.In this study,we systemically identified protein kinases from the predicted proteomes of 59 representative fungi from Ascomycota and Basidiomycota.Comparative analysis revealed that fungi from Ascomycota and Basidiomycota differed in the number and variety of protein kinases.Some groups of protein kinases,such as calmodulin/calcium regulated kinases(CMGC) and those with the highest group percentages are the most prevalent protein kinases among all fungal species tested.In contrast,the STE group(homologs of the yeast STE7,STE11 and STE20 genes),was more abundant in Basidiomycetes than in Ascomycetes.Importantly,the distribution of some protein kinase families appeared to be subphylum-specific.The tyrosine kinase-like(TKL) group had a higher protein kinase density in Agaricomycotina fungi.In addition,the distribution of accessory domains,which could have functional implications,demonstrated that usage bias varied between the two phyla.Principal component analysis revealed a divergence between the main functional domains and associated domains in fungi.This study provides novel insights into the variety and expansion of fungal protein kinases between Ascomycota and Basidiomycota.

文摘Diabetes is a chronic metabolic disease with an increasing incidence rate year by year.it severely diminishes the quality of life for individuals,reduces life expectancy,and poses a significant public health issue in worldwide.Medicinal fungi,as a large group of microorganisms,possess abundant food and medicinal value,as well as vast research potential.This review describes the antidiabetic activities of seven medicinal fungi from subphylum Ascomycota,including Monascus purpureus,Cordyceps militaris,Ophiocordyceps sinensis,Cordyceps cicadae,Shiraia bambusicola,Claviceps purpurea,and Xylaria nigripes.it provides readers with evidence and information on the medicinal fungi(subphylum Ascomycota)with hypoglycemic effects,as well as their compounds for hypoglycemic properties.

文摘The Yellow River Delta(YRD)of China is one of the most active land-sea interaction deltas in the world.However,due to human activities and climate change,it has undergone significant changes,including the degradation of natural wetlands and saltwater intrusion.As an integral part of soil microorganisms,fungi play a crucial role in maintaining and stabilizing the function of wetland ecosystems.To better understand the composition and diversity changes of fungal communities along a salinity gradient in the YRD of China and their relationship with environmental factors,fungal diversity,abundance,and composition in the sediments of four typical vegetation communities spanning from the riverbank to the seaside were investigated.The results showed that the electrical conductivity(EC)increased significantly from the riverbank to the coastal area(P<0.05),but the levels of total nitrogen(TN),total carbon(TC),total sulfur(TS),available phosphorous(AP),and ammonium(NH_(4)^(+)-N)increased in Phragmites australis community and then experienced a significant decrease in Tamarix chinensis community and Suaeda salsa community(P<0.05).The alpha diversity(Shannon and Simpson indices)of the soil fungal community exhibited a negative correlation with EC.There was a significant alteration in the structure of the fungal community,primarily influenced by EC and NO_(3)^(-)-N.Ascomycota was found to be the most abundant phylum,and its relative abundance is positively correlated with pH and TS.The relative abundance of Sordariomycetes,the second-largest class of Ascomycota,reached 38.95%.Salinity was identified as the most important factor driving changes in soil fungal community composition.In summary,the fungal community changed significantly along the salinity gradient,and different environmental factors impacted various tiers of fungal populations differently.The findings of this study lay the groundwork for comprehending soil fungal communities and their primary influencing factors in newly formed wetlands.

文摘Diaporthales is an important group of fungi widely distributed worldwide as endophytes,pathogens,and saprobes on the various plants.Here,we collected and isolated 209 strains of the Diaporthales and then employed morphological characteristics and advanced techniques such as multigene phylogenetics,genomic phylogenetics,molecular clock estimates,and metabolic pathways annotations to explore the evolutionary diversification and metabolic pathways within the Diaporthales.Firstly,our study confirmed that Diaporthales occurred early with a mean stem age of 181.5 Mya and a mean crown age of 157.7 Mya.Secondly,two new families,Sinodisculaceae fam.nov.and Ternstroemiomycetaceae fam.nov.,were introduced based on morphology,phylogeny,and divergence times.Thirdly,we further described multiple novel taxa or records including Anadiaporthostoma gen.nov.(Diaporthostomataceae),Lunatospora gen.nov.(Sinodisculaceae),Microphaeotubakia gen.nov.(Tubakiaceae),Neoplagiostoma gen.nov.(Pseudoplagiostomataceae),and Ternstroemiomyces gen.nov.(Ternstroemiomycetaceae),55 new species,three new species complexes,32 new host records,and three new combinations.Furthermore,we accepted 35 families within the Diaporthales based on analysis of multiple evidences.Additionally,high activity in universal pathways such as purine metabolism and ribosome across the order suggested a fundamental for robust growth and stress response in Diaporthales.These findings enrich fungal biodiversity and provide critical insights into the evolutionary processes in these communities.
文摘采集湖南省新宁县崀山世界自然遗产风景名胜区和广西省乐业县雅长兰科植物自然保护区这两个生境中处于生长期的铁皮石斛(Dendrobium of ficinale)的营养根,并进行分离培养。通过对分离所得的41个菌株进行形态观察和ITS序列测定相结合的鉴定,共获得内生真菌34种。对担子菌和子囊菌分别进行了系统发育树构建结果显示,子囊菌为优势种类(31种),以炭角菌目(Xylariales)和肉座菌目(Hypocreales)的种类为主,担子菌则以胶膜菌科(Tulasnellaceae)为主。Simpson多样性指数分析结果表明,不同生境下野生铁皮石斛内生真菌的多样性都很高,且雅长的高于崀山的。
